Brief summary
Women with Gestational Diabetes (GDM) are recommended to monitor their blood glucose levels (BGLs) aiming at tight control to improve the risk of adverse outcomes. After initial review, our service undertakes weekly phone or email contact with women for surveillance of glycaemia. This creates a significant treatment burden for the patient and clinician. We are investigating the use of the Net-Health mobile phone application (app) and linked glucose meter, as part of a blood glucose management system in women with GDM. This app: 1) Automatically uploads BGLs in real time to a secure server for review remotely by the treating team; 2) Automatically generates an email alert to the treating team if BGLs are out of target range; 3) Allows messaging via the app for dose titration if required. We plan to undertake a pilot study of 100 women, recruited from our GDM group education session. Data will be collected to assess feasibility, patient satisfaction and resource utilisation. We will also gather data to explore patterns of glycaemia, maternal and neonatal outcomes. We hypothesize this management system will be feasible and will lead to a more efficient and responsive model of care and use of resources.
Interventions
This study of women diagnosed with Gestational Diabetes Mellitis (GDM) will investigate the feasibility, acceptability and patient satisfaction with the use of the Net-Health smartphone application (app). The app will collect baseline information at time of registration including age, ethnicity, family history of type 2 diabetes, height, pre pregnancy weight, gestational weight gain, gestation, number of previous pregnancies and previous GDM (including type of treatment). After registration, the mobile app will be linked via bluetooth to the blood glucose meter and used to transfer fingerprick BGLs automatically to a secure central server for remote monitoring by the treating team. The app contains some instructions about its use and women will have direct contact details for the diabetes educators if there are any questions about its use. It has the capacity to transfer blood pressure (BP) results from linked home BP machines. The Net-Health server will notify the treating team if 3 or more BGLs are out of range within 1 week via an automatically generated email to prompt expedited phone or clinic review. Duration of the intervention will be from time of consent (after diagnosis between 24-30 weeks gestation) to and will cease after delivery. Adherence will be assessed at clinic appointments with the number of BGL's reviewed and at completion of the study with number of BGL's submitted (compared with expected 4 per day from consent to delivery). Text reminders may be sent at routine follow up of BGL's at prespecified time points in care.

Eligibility
Inclusion criteria
1. Women with confirmed GDM on routine screening between 24-30 weeks gestation. 2. Singleton pregnancy. 3. Own or have the use of a smartphone. 4. Demonstrate willingness and ability to use a linked glucose meter and mobile phone application. 5. Willing and able to give informed consent.
Exclusion criteria
1. High risk pregnancies not suitable for reduced frequency of review including: • Twins or higher gestation • Known risk factors for obstetric complications (other than obesity or GDM) • Any evidence of fetal compromise 2. GDM diagnosed earlier or later than time period for routine screening (24-30 weeks gestation) that may represent a higher risk of pre-existing diabetes or normal late gestation insulin resistance.
